Charcoal drawing of a coat of arms

An alternative technique is the use of charcoal pencils. Charcoal is only suitable for very large formats. For smaller drawings of coats of arms in black and white the graphite pencil is to be preferred. We use the graphite pencil to achieve similar but slightly finer results.


Acrylgemälde eines Wappens

In addition to the watercolor, the acrylic painting is another technique to implement a coat of arms in color. Again, a large format is recommended. The coat of arms is painted on a canvas. Advantage of a canvas on stretcher is that an additional removable frame is not mandatory.
